CMS Peripherals has announced a new version of its ABSplus backup system, bootable for Mac OS X. The new system features a redesigned chassis with shock mounting, as well.
A FireWire-based system equipped with an internal hard-drive, the ABSplus automatically launches a backup when the drive is plugged in. The system features a “quick install” software setup with “express” and advanced settings choices. It can alternately be used as an additional storage system. CMS said the system is rugged, too — it can withstand a non-operating shock of more than 1000 Gs.
Look for the new ABSplus to ship in August for a suggested retail price starting at US$299. It’ll be available in capacities from 20 to 60GB.
